A site plan shows the invert elevation of a building sewer as 102.50 ft at the upstream end and 101.90 ft at the downstream end, with 48 ft of run between the two points. What is the slope of the sewer in inches per foot?

a.0.0125 in per ft
b.0.10 in per ft
c.0.125 in per ft
d.0.15 in per ft

Explanation

The fall is 102.50 - 101.90 = 0.60 ft, which is 0.60 x 12 = 7.2 in, and 7.2 in divided by the 48 ft run gives 0.15 in per ft. The value 0.0125 is the slope expressed in feet per foot, not inches per foot, so it is off by a factor of 12. One tenth of an inch per foot would produce only 4.8 in of fall over 48 ft, and 0.125 in per ft, the familiar 1/8 in per ft grade, would produce 6 in of fall. Both are plausible-looking but leave the pipe higher than the plan calls for at the connection.
